Spotting the Signs of Chloramine in Your Water
If every time you run your tap water you notice an unusual chemical odor, you might be dealing with chloramine contamination. This compound, often used in municipal water treatment, can linger in your plumbing and affect your water’s taste and smell. It's crucial to be attentive to these changes, as they can impact daily activities like cooking, drinking, and bathing.

Effective Treatment with Carbon Chlorine Technology
Carbon chlorine filters are an effective solution for removing chloramine from your water supply. These filters utilize activated carbon to adsorb and neutralize chloramine molecules, resulting in cleaner and fresher water.
Here’s why carbon chlorine technology is a preferred choice for many homeowners:
- Advanced Filtration: Activated carbon is known for its extensive surface area, which allows it to trap contaminants effectively.
- Improved Taste and Odor: Aside from eliminating chloramine, this method also enhances the overall taste and sensory qualities of your water.

Maintaining Your Carbon Chlorine Filter
Proper maintenance is essential to keep your carbon chlorine filter working efficiently. Here’s what to keep in mind:
- Regular Filter Replacement: Filters typically need to be replaced every 6 to 12 months, depending on usage and water quality.
- Periodic System Cleaning: Some systems require occasional cleaning to prevent buildup and ensure optimal flow.
- Checking for Damages: Regularly inspect the filter housing for any leaks or cracks that could compromise its effectiveness.

Understanding Chloramine
Chloramine is a compound formed when chlorine combines with ammonia, often used by municipal water systems as a disinfectant. Unlike chlorine, which dissipates quickly, chloramine remains in water for longer periods, making it effective for maintaining water quality during transport. However, its persistent nature presents unique challenges for residential water filtration.

Common Misconceptions about Chloramine
- Chloramine is harmless: While it is safe for most people, certain vulnerable groups may react negatively.
- Chloramine is the same as chlorine: Chloramine has different chemical properties and does not dissipate from water as chlorine does.
- All filters remove chloramine equally: Not all filtration systems are designed to effectively remove chloramine; it's crucial to check compatibility before purchase.

The Role of Pre-Filters
Incorporating a pre-filter before the main filtration system can enhance performance by removing larger particulates and some chlorine content. This can extend the lifespan of the main filter and improve overall water quality.
